让新生代小鲜肉倾倒的代码生成器,向枯燥说拜拜!
2023-09-19 23:04:55
解锁代码生成利器:摆脱枯燥,拥抱高效
导言
在当今瞬息万变的科技时代,时间就是金钱,效率就是生命,这一点对于新生代的小鲜肉程序员来说尤为突出。传统的手工敲代码方式已经无法满足他们快节奏的需求,因此,代码生成器应运而生,成为他们手中的利器。
Scaffolding Tool:脚手架的艺术
Scaffolding Tool,顾名思义,就是脚手架工具。它为你提供了一个预先构建好的项目结构和代码模板,让你可以快速搭建项目框架,省去从零开始的繁琐工作。犹如建造摩天大楼时所搭建的脚手架,Scaffolding Tool 为你的代码构建之旅提供了坚实的基础。
Yeoman:开源界的扛把子
Yeoman 是 JavaScript 领域最负盛名的代码生成器之一,拥有超过 10000 颗星的 GitHub 点赞。它集成了丰富的插件生态系统,涵盖各种前端和后端技术,为你提供全方位的代码生成支持。Yeoman 就像一位经验丰富的导师,引导你轻松踏上代码生成之路。
一键生成,告别枯燥
有了 Scaffolding Tool 和 Yeoman 的加持,你可以轻松一键生成项目代码,涵盖 HTML、CSS、JavaScript、React、Angular、Vue.js 等主流技术栈。只需输入几个简单的命令,就能快速搭建出一个完整的项目结构,包括目录、文件、代码模板等。从此,告别枯燥的重复性工作,让你的代码生成变得高效且优雅。
定制化配置,满足个性需求
代码生成器并非千篇一律,Scaffolding Tool 和 Yeoman 都支持高度的定制化配置。你可以根据自己的喜好和项目需求,选择不同的模板、插件和配置选项,打造出独一无二的代码生成方案。犹如一位技艺精湛的工匠,你可以根据自己的需求定制一把趁手的工具。
技术指南:实战演练
现在,就让我们来实战一下吧!
安装 Scaffolding Tool 和 Yeoman
npm install -g scaffolding-tool
npm install -g yo
创建 React 项目
scaffolding-tool react
选择模板和配置
按照提示选择 React 项目模板和配置选项。
生成项目代码
yo react
Voilà!一个完整的 React 项目就新鲜出炉啦!
结语
新生代小鲜肉们,还在为枯燥的编码工作而烦恼吗?快来拥抱代码生成器吧!
Scaffolding Tool 和 Yeoman 将为你插上腾飞的翅膀,让你在代码的世界中自由翱翔。告别繁琐,拥抱高效,释放你的创造力,成为代码生成界的弄潮儿!
常见问题解答
1. 代码生成器是否会取代程序员?
答:不会。代码生成器只是一个工具,它可以帮助程序员提高效率,但它无法取代程序员的创造力、解决问题的能力和对编程语言的深刻理解。
2. 我应该使用哪个代码生成器?
答:这取决于你的具体需求。对于 JavaScript 项目,Yeoman 是一个不错的选择。如果你需要跨语言的支持,你可以考虑使用 Apache Velocity 或 Freemarker 等更通用的代码生成工具。
3. 代码生成器生成的代码质量如何?
答:代码生成器生成的代码质量取决于所使用的模板和配置选项。一般来说,建议使用社区维护良好的模板并进行必要的定制,以确保生成的代码符合你的质量标准。
4. 代码生成器是否适用于所有编程语言?
答:不。虽然代码生成器可以用于生成各种编程语言的代码,但它们通常针对特定的语言或技术栈而设计。例如,Yeoman 主要用于生成 JavaScript 代码。
5. 我应该学习如何使用代码生成器吗?
答:是的。学习如何使用代码生成器可以帮助你提高效率并创建更健壮的代码。花一些时间探索 Scaffolding Tool 和 Yeoman 等工具,你会发现它们对你的代码开发工作非常有帮助。